SEM-Base®VIisthe next generation in STACIS active piezoelectric vibration cancellation.
SEM-BaseVIcan support many Focused Ion Beam (FIB) and Small Dual Beam instruments, as well asall commercial Scanning Electron Microscopes (SEMs).
SEM-BaseVIoffers enhanced vibration isolation performance, a faster, more robust controller, and an advanced graphical user interface (GUI). SEM-BaseVIwill enable more labs and facilities to achieve the level of floor vibration required to satisfy the tool manufacturer's specifications.
SEM-Base VI employs a unique “serial architecture” where the vibration sensors quantify floor vibration, not payload vibration. This guarantees that contrary to other designs, payload resonances do not integrally restrict vibration isolation or result in instability.
For maximum sensitivity in the hard-to-measure sub-Hz range, the vibration sensors are low-frequency inertial velocity sensors. Integrated with the unique piezo-actuator technology, SEM-Base VI attains very high levels of vibration cancellation, even on already quiet floors.
On average, SEM-Base VI offers 6 dB more vibration isolation compared to the earlier models. In addition, the DC-2020, which is TMC’s next-generation controller, characterizes a new dual-core processor and offers tool owners and scientists a very practical and user-friendly graphical interface for operational peace of mind and quick system assessment.
When connecting over Ethernet, the DC-2020 creates the SEM-Base GUI in the user's browser without having to install any additional software or application programs. Alternatively, the user can interface with the controller via an onboard menu-driven Liquid Crystal Display (LCD).
The SEM-Base VI Advantage
Active Inertial Vibration Cancellation – SEM-Base VI employs high-sensitivity, low-frequency inertial velocity sensors to attain high levels of vibration attenuation, even on quiet floors.
Hard-Mount Technology – SEM-Base VI is compatible with all internal SEM vibration control systems and aggressively mitigates low-frequency floor vibration starting at 0.6 Hz.
Serial Design with Piezoelectric Technology – The unique serial design and proprietary high-force piezoelectric technology results in a wide active bandwidth from 0.6 Hz to 150 Hz and unmatched, inertial active vibration cancellation with 90% reduction starting at 2 Hz.
Specifications
Performance Specifications. Source: TMC Vibration Control
. | . |
---|---|
Active degrees of freedom | 6 |
Active bandwidth | 0.6 Hz - 100 Hz |
Passive natural frequency | 12 Hz nominal |
Effective active resonant frequency | 0.5 Hz |
Isolation at 1 Hz | 40% - 70% |
Isolation at 2 Hz | 90% |
Isolation at≥3 Hz | 90-98% |
Internal noise | <0.1 nm RMS |
Operating load range | Standard capacity: 900 - 2,500 lbs (408 - 1134 kg)High capacity: 2,500 - 3,200lbs (1134 - 1452 kg) |
Magnetic field emitted at maximum4 in.(102 mm) from the platform | <0.02μG broadband RMS |
Design, Dimensions, and Environmental and Utility Requirements. Source: TMC Vibration Control
. | . |
---|---|
Environmental and safety | CE and RoHS compliant |
Active isolation elements | Piezoelectric actuators with minimum 3300 lb. (1500 kg) capacity receive signal from a high-voltage amplifier with an output of up to 800 VDC. Vertical actuators support the isolated payload. |
Passive isolation element | single stiff elastomer (no compressed air supply required) |
Vibration sensor elements | downward facing geophone type inertial sensorsthat measure floor vibration below the isolatorand deliver voltage proportional to the velocity of vibration motion |
Active feedback control loop | Floor vibration is measured, processedand attenuated below the springsupporting the isolated surface |
Dimensions (WxD) | 35.25 x 44.25 in.895 x 1124 mm |
Height | 6.3 in. (160 mm) nominal,doesn't change when SEM-Base is switched off |
Operating temperature | 50° - 90° F10° - 32° C |
Storage temperature | -40° - 130° F-40° - 55° C |
Humidity | < 80% @ 68° F | 20° C, Maximum dewpoint 18 degrees C |
System power requirements | 100, 120, 230, 240 VAC50/60 Hz AC; <600 WCE compliant |
Floor displacement | <800 μin. (20 μm) below 10 Hz |
